Simplified Explanation
The patent application describes a device that predicts the order of events based on event data using an attention mechanism.
- Acquisition means gathers event data related to an event.
- Prediction means forecasts the level of interest for each data item in the event data and predicts the order using an attention mechanism.
- Output means provides the prediction result including the degree of interest and order probability.

Original Abstract Submitted
In an order prediction device, an acquisition means acquires event data related to an event. A prediction means predicts a degree of interest with respect to each data item included in the event data and an order prediction by using an attention mechanism based on the event data. An output means outputs, as a prediction result, the degree of interest and an order probability.
